Transaction 3a6936a46a658bb5dd08363a7bf439331e078cd2d5a39a6540f76d0f12d15867
2 Input
2 Outputs
- 3a6936a46a658bb5dd08363a7bf439331e078cd2d5a39a6540f76d0f12d15867:0
- 3a6936a46a658bb5dd08363a7bf439331e078cd2d5a39a6540f76d0f12d15867:1
value 569624
address 3Hbym1zYk6nSEkHx2Kozo7YTxDMbFiw37i
value 5697
address 32dzntikSsTSnfeyKazYRT1Z41SWpxBjjM